## Retry failed exports

This PR adds bounded retries to the Fernwick export pipeline. Failed jobs now back off exponentially instead of being dropped, and permanently failed exports land in a dead-letter table for manual review. Behavior is unchanged for successful runs. Retry limits were sized against the Caldermoor batch workload. The tuning constants introduced by this change are listed below.

constants for hahip-hafog:
WEIGHTS = {
    "feniel": 55,
    "kasox": 667,
}

**Q: How does Flagpole gate rollouts?**

A: Flags evaluate server-side only; clients never receive rule definitions. Targeting rules are signed at publish time and verified on load. Percentage rollouts use salted hashing per flag, so user buckets can't be correlated across flags. Kill switches bypass cache and propagate within 30 seconds. Audit logs record every flag change with actor and diff. For the threat model doc or signing-key rotation policy, send requests here.

escalation mailbox, bafog-fafog: ulador@paliqlabs.internal

### Step 4: Deduplicate customer records

Before enabling the Meridock sync, run the dedupe pass against the customer table. The job merges records by normalized name and postal fields, keeping the oldest record as canonical. Expect roughly a 3% merge rate on typical datasets. The dedupe job reads its settings from the block below.

deployment values, kajep-kageg:
[praix]
host = praix.paliqcorp.corp
user = praix_svc
database = praix_prod